

For the past 35 years, Shelby Conrad has consistently exemplified a commitment to quality, safe work, exceptional leadership and customer service. says his employer Skanska USA Civil West. Shelby's commitment to delivering quality work the first time enables Skanska to avoid impacts to sensitive schedules and budgets in complex urban communities.
Dave Walker, Senior Director of Construction Management at LACMTA, describes Shelby as “great with managing contract schedules and organizing his staff. If Shelby tells you that he will get something done,” Dave says, “You can take it to the bank.”
Shelby’s had a tremendous impact on the Exposition LRT Phase II project. When Skanska’s subcontractors were struggling to keep to the schedule, Shelby came on board as trackwork manager. His impact was clear: Expo II finished on time, was the first transit project in the United States to be certified Envision Platinum and was recognized for reaching one million manhours without a lost-time incident.
On complex projects since then, Shelby has been successful by focusing on means and methods and constructability and by constantly seeking ways to improve quality and safety.
Shelby describes his approach to work as “doing nothing less than you say you will, doing it right the first time, focusing on quality and safety, and always looking for ways to improve.”
Clients agree that Shelby consistently goes above and beyond. Dave Walker adds that Shelby is a “standout leader who has always done an outstanding job for the projects. He has taken on responsibilities most would not, and always done an exemplary job in doing so.”
